## Relevance tuning: limits and quotas

Scope: the Tarnwick search stack only. Boost weights are clamped at query time; exceeding them is a hard error, not a warning. Reviewers should reject changes that bypass the clamp in `rank_core`. Quotas reset per tenant at midnight. Current enforced limits are listed below.

constants for tafog-kahag:
RATE_LIMITS = {
    "sorir": 697,
    "oliox": 683,
    "holax": 176,
    "casox": 60,
    "pelius": 382,
}

**Ticket: Stale firmware pushed to beta channel**

Devices enrolled in the Lanterbeck beta channel received build artifacts from two cycles ago after last night's channel sync. The manifest resolver appears to sort releases lexically rather than by version, so anything past version 9 regresses. New team members: the channel config lives in the updater repo, not the device repo. Reproduced on three bench units. The affected artifact's token appears below.

pipeline stamp: htk9_ce63042d9

## Service accounts — Sheetwrangle CSV import wizard

Heads up, future maintainers: the import wizard doesn't run as the logged-in user. It uses the svc-sheetwrangle account to push parsed rows into the internal Rowbarrel API. That means permission bugs usually aren't the user's fault — check the service account's scopes first. The account is provisioned per environment; staging and prod keys are not interchangeable, and yes, people mix them up constantly. The current staging key is below.

app token of kagap-fahag = zpat2_0m

Subject: Quickstore 4.2 — bloom filter now fronts the KV layer

Plugin authors: starting with this release, Quickstore places a bloom filter ahead of the key-value store. Negative lookups return faster; false positives fall through safely. No API changes are required on your side. Verify your plugin against the staging build referenced below.

session token of fahif-tadup = htk3_9c7